As we commemorate the Day of the African Child 2025, the Center for Advocacy in Gender Equality and Action for Development (CAGEAD) reaffirms her dedication to promoting the rights and well-being of young people in the Northwest Region. With a focus on adolescent girls and boys, CAGEAD's innovative initiatives have made significant strides in breaking down barriers and fostering a supportive environment for growth.

CAGEAD's establishment of 15 Menstrual Hygiene Management (MHM) school clubs has been a game-changer. By providing essential resources, menstrual kits, and menstrual-friendly facilities, these clubs have empowered adolescent girls to manage their menstruation with dignity and confidence. This initiative has not only improved their academic performance but also helped break down societal taboos surrounding menstruation.

Recognizing the impact of crises on vulnerable communities, CAGEAD has gone beyond schools to support adolescent girls and boys in Ntamulung and Santa Village. By distributing income-generating activity items, the organization aims to equip youth with the skills and resources needed to navigate challenging circumstances and build a brighter future.

CAGEAD's advocacy work also plays a crucial role in promoting adolescent rights. Through research, community engagement, and policy dialogue, CAGEAD pushes for systemic changes that benefit young people. By engaging with local authorities, stakeholders, communities, and councils, CAGEAD ensures that the voices of adolescents are heard and their needs are integrated into policies and programs. This advocacy work complements CAGEAD's grassroots initiatives, creating a comprehensive approach to adolescent empowerment.
